C++ projeleri, geniş yetenek yelpazesi ve güçlü özellikleri sayesinde farklı alanlarda projeler geliştirmek için ideal bir programlama dilidir. C++ projeleri, hem başlangıç seviyesindeki programcılar için pratik yapma fırsatı sunar hem de deneyimli geliştiricilerin daha karmaşık uygulamalar oluşturmasına olanak tanır. Bu projeler, programlama yeteneklerini geliştirmenin yanı sıra problem çözme becerilerini artırmak, nesne yönelimli programlama prensiplerini uygulamak ve C++’ın performans avantajlarını görmek için mükemmel bir yoldur. Geniş çapta prensiplere özen gösterilmesi sonrasında bu projelerin etkili olması desteklenmiş olur.
Başlangıç seviyesindeki öğrenciler için basit konsol tabanlı uygulamalar oluşturmak iyi bir adım olabilir. Örneğin, hesap makinesi, not defteri veya basit bir oyuncak oyun gibi projeler, temel dil yapısını anlama ve kod yazma pratiği yapma açısından faydalıdır. Daha sonra, veri yapıları ve algoritmalar üzerine çalışan projeler, öğrencilere programın verimli ve düzenli çalışmasını nasıl sağlayabileceklerini öğretebilir.
Orta seviye öğrenciler için, dosya işleme, metin düzenleme araçları veya mini veritabanları gibi projeler, daha karmaşık yapılara yönelmenin bir yoludur. Aynı zamanda grafik kütüphanelerini kullanarak basit oyunlar geliştirmek, öğrencilere kullanıcı arayüzü tasarlama ve oyun mekaniğini anlama konusunda deneyim kazandırabilir.
Deneyimli geliştiriciler için, C++ projeleri daha büyük ve karmaşık hale gelebilir. Örneğin, sistem yazılımları, işletim sistemleri, oyun motorları veya gömülü sistemler için yazılım geliştirme gibi alanlarda çalışmak mümkündür. Bu tür projeler, bellek yönetimi, çoklu iş parçacığı (threading), düşük seviyeli işlemler ve performans optimizasyonu gibi ileri seviye konuları içerebilir.
Daha Kapsamlı Bilgi Edinin: Programlama
C++ ile Hangi Projeler Yapılır?
İçerikler
C++ Programlama dili projeleri oldukça zengindir. Özellikle kapsamının yüksek olması, geniş yelpazede kullanımı desteklemesi gibi çok çeşitli imkanları sayesinde tercih edilen bu uygulamanın kullanımı sonrasında memnuniyetin desteklendiği görülür.
C++ programlama dili, geniş yetenek yelpazesi ile farklı türde projelerin geliştirilmesi için ideal bir zemin sunar. Özellikle oyun geliştirme alanında, 2D ve 3D oyunlar için oyun motorları ve grafik kütüphaneleri kullanarak etkileyici projeler oluşturabilirsiniz. Ayrıca, sistem ve uygulama geliştirme, veri yapıları ve algoritmalar, bilimsel hesaplamalar, gömülü sistemler, ağ ve internet uygulamaları gibi çeşitli alanlarda C++ ile projeler hayata geçirilebilir. C++’ın esnekliği ve performansı, projelerin daha sağlam temeller üzerine inşa edilmesini sağlayarak özgün ve etkili çözümler sunmanıza olanak tanır.
C++ Projeleri Ne İçin Kullanılır?
C++ bilgisayar programı geniş sistematiğe sahiptir. Bununla beraber farklı alanlarda kullanılır.. Sistem programlamasında C++ proje fikirleri, işletim sistemleri, sürücü yazılımları ve sistem seviyesinde uygulamalar oluşturmak için tercih edilir. Bu dili kullanarak donanım ile etkileşimde bulunabilir ve düşük seviyeli işlemleri kontrol edebilirsiniz. Oyun geliştirme, C++’ın performans avantajlarından yararlandığı bir diğer alan olarak öne çıkar. Hem bağımsız oyunlar hem de büyük oyun stüdyoları tarafından tercih edilen C++, hızlı işlem yapma yeteneği ile daha gerçekçi grafikler ve etkileyici oyun mekanikleri oluşturmanıza olanak tanır.
Veri yapıları ve algoritmalar, C++ ile uygulamanın en etkili olduğu alanlardan biridir. Özellikle büyük veri kümeleri üzerinde hızlı işlemler yapmak veya karmaşık algoritmaları uygulamak için tercih edilir.
Gömülü sistemlerde, mikro denetleyiciler ve gömülü cihazlar için kontrol yazılımı geliştirmek için C++ kullanılır. Bu alan, ev aletlerinden endüstriyel otomasyona kadar geniş bir uygulama yelpazesi sunar.
Sıkça Sorulan Sorular
C++ Projeleri ile Ne Yapılır?
Bu programlama dili ile uygulamaların geliştirilmesi gibi çeşitli destekler sağlanır.
C++ Projeleri Hangi Programlama Dilidir?
C++, genel amaçlı bir programlama dilidir. Yani, farklı türde uygulamalar geliştirmek için kullanılabilir. C++, hem yüksek seviyeli programlama yeteneklerine sahip bir dildir hem de düşük seviyeli donanım kontrolleri yapma yeteneğine sahiptir.